# All are required to authenticate.
Example config file with variables:
"
---
providers:
config:
class: octodns.provider.yaml.YamlProvider
directory: ./config (example path to directory of zone files)
azuredns:
class: octodns.provider.azuredns.AzureProvider
client_id: env/AZURE_APPLICATION_ID
key: env/AZURE_AUTHENICATION_KEY
directory_id: env/AZURE_DIRECTORY_ID
sub_id: env/AZURE_SUBSCRIPTION_ID
resource_group: 'TestResource1'
zones:
example.com.:
sources:
- config
targets:
- azuredns
"
The first four variables above can be hidden in environment variables
and octoDNS will automatically search for them in the shell. It is
possible to also hard-code into the config file. resource_group can
also be an environment variable but might likely change.
